
The Tamper Evident Labeler Market is expanding steadily as industries prioritize product safety, anti-counterfeiting measures, and regulatory compliance. Tamper evident labeling systems have become an essential part of modern packaging operations, particularly in the food, beverage, pharmaceutical, and cosmetics industries. The market was valued at USD 2.56 billion in 2025 and is projected to reach USD 4.75 billion by 2034, growing at a CAGR of 7.1% during the forecast period from 2026 to 2034.
The increasing prevalence of counterfeit products, stricter packaging regulations, and rising consumer awareness regarding product authenticity are major factors supporting market growth. Additionally, manufacturers are integrating advanced automation, IoT connectivity, and AI-powered inspection systems into labeling equipment to improve production efficiency and ensure labeling accuracy.

Tamper Evident Labeler Market Segmentation Analysis
Product Type Analysis
The Tamper Evident Labeler Market is segmented into seal, shrink sleeve, and breakable labels.
Seal labels remain widely used because of their affordability, ease of application, and effectiveness in indicating package tampering. They are particularly common across food and beverage packaging applications.
Shrink sleeve labels continue gaining popularity due to their full-container coverage, superior branding opportunities, and enhanced product security. These labels are extensively used in beverage, cosmetics, and personal care packaging.
Breakable labels are primarily utilized in high-security applications where immediate visual evidence of tampering is essential, particularly in pharmaceutical and healthcare packaging.

Market Challenges and Industry Barriers
Despite favorable growth prospects, the Tamper Evident Labeler Market faces several challenges.
The high capital investment required for advanced labeling systems remains one of the primary barriers, particularly for small and medium-sized manufacturers. Installation costs, production line modifications, and employee training increase the overall implementation expense.
System integration also presents operational challenges, especially when upgrading existing manufacturing facilities with modern automated labeling equipment.
Competition from alternative product authentication technologies, including RFID tags, holographic labels, QR code verification, and smart packaging solutions, continues influencing purchasing decisions. Manufacturers must therefore deliver cost-effective, flexible, and technologically advanced labeling systems to remain competitive.
